1

簡単なことだと思うので問題があります。

mysqlデータベースに接続したい。

私が次のことをした場合:

mysql -uroot -premoved mydatabase
ERROR 1045 (28000): Access denied for user 'root'@'localhost' (using password: YES)

しかし、私がそうする場合:

mysql -uroot -p mydatabase
Enter password: removed
mysql>

できます!!なんで?

4

1 に答える 1

1

パスワードを一重引用符で囲む必要があります。

mysql -uroot '-pabc$def' mydatabase

mysqlパスワードが参照用に私のダンプを台無しにしているのを参照してください。

于 2013-01-30T19:02:25.177 に答える